Ofsted Insights
What This School Does Well
This school provides an ambitious, carefully planned curriculum where teachers really know their subjects and support each child individually. The early years provision is outstanding, giving children a wonderful foundation in language and learning. Your child will be part of an inclusive, welcoming community that celebrates different cultures and beliefs, with strong support for all learners including those with additional needs.
Key Strengths
- Highly ambitious curriculum with strong focus on language and communication skills - pupils apply vocabulary confidently in their learning
- Excellent teaching with very strong subject knowledge - teachers use questioning skilfully to identify gaps and provide swift support
- Outstanding early years provision - children receive a rich language environment and develop number and mathematical skills expertly
- High-quality SEND support - pupils' needs are identified swiftly with precise targets and careful adaptations to help them access the curriculum
- Reading is a high priority - pupils make rapid progress towards becoming accurate and fluent readers with access to a rich variety of books
Areas for Improvement
- Behaviour management inconsistencies - some pupils' behaviour and bullying concerns are not always dealt with effectively and remain unresolved
- Need for consistent implementation of behaviour policy across the school to support pupils' individual behaviour needs
- Some pupils do not behave as well as they could despite high school expectations
Safeguarding
Safeguarding arrangements are effective with an open and positive culture that puts pupils' interests first.
Extracurricular Activities
Anti-bullying ambassadors, pupil parliament, school trips, lunchtime clubs for SEND pupils, after-school clubs (leadership, sporting, gardening, bible), choir performances at local church and care home, attendance ambassadors
Christ Church (Erith) CofE Primary School is an inclusive primary school where pupils achieve well through a carefully matched, ambitious curriculum. The school has made rapid progress in curriculum development with outstanding early years provision and strong teaching across the school.
